Sepang extends Formula 1 deal to 2018

– Sepang will continue to play host to the Malaysian Grand Prix after organisers agreed a new deal to remain on the Formula 1 calendar until 2018.The circuit joined the roster in 1999 and has remained present ever since, though this year's event was the last on a deal which was signed back in 2007.But after Sebastian Vettel's win on Sunday, organisers confirmed that the track had finalised a fresh deal to hold the Malaysian Grand Prix for at least three more seasons.Petronas has also extended its title sponsorship of the event for the duration of the new contract.
